约瑟夫·斯法基斯
模型检测技术的先驱
约瑟夫·斯法基斯是模型检测技术的先驱,他的工作使得计算机硬件和软件系统的验证变得更加高效和可靠。
形式化方法不是银弹,但它们是追求可靠系统的重要工具。
"Formal methods are not a silver bullet, but they are an essential tool in the quest for reliable systems."
